Oracle 10g RAC+DataGuard实施全攻略:构建高可用架构步骤详解

5星 · 超过95%的资源 需积分: 10 130 下载量 21 浏览量 更新于2024-12-28 2 收藏 181KB PDF 举报
Oracle 10g RAC (Real Application Clustering) + DataGuard是一种先进的数据库高可用性解决方案,旨在提供企业级的数据保护和业务连续性。本文档是"MAA/DataGuard 10g Setup Guide - 创建RAC Primary的物理备用",发布于2007年3月,作为Oracle最佳实践系列白皮书的一部分。该指南详细阐述了在实施Oracle 10g RAC环境中配置DataGuard的步骤,以确保最大可用性。 1. **创建RAC Physical Standby(物理备用)** - 在实施过程中,首要任务是收集所有必要的文件并进行备份。这包括数据库、网络配置文件以及任何其他相关设置,以确保在灾难发生时能够恢复数据。 2. **配置Oracle Net Services on the Standby** - Oracle Net Services在RAC和DataGuard架构中的作用至关重要。在备用站点上配置这些服务,确保两个站点之间的通信顺畅,包括监听器配置、网络连接设置和SSL/TLS安全选项。 3. **创建Standby实例和数据库** - 创建一个与Primary实例兼容的Standby数据库涉及安装和配置新的Oracle实例,同时同步数据文件、控制文件和redo日志。这通常通过使用Data Guard的辅助进程(如DGDBMS)来完成。 4. **配置Primary Database for DataGuard** - Primary数据库的配置需要调整以支持DataGuard功能,这包括设置归档模式、启用闪回恢复、配置归档日志、以及设置远程复制参数等。 5. **验证DataGuard配置** - 在所有步骤完成后,对DataGuard配置进行全面检查,包括连接测试、数据同步状态、备份策略等,以确认系统可以无缝地在主备切换时接管业务。 6. **参考文档** - 最后,文中提供了详细的参考文献列表,供读者进一步深入学习和参考Oracle 10g RAC和DataGuard的最佳实践、技术细节和常见问题解决方案。 实施Oracle 10g RAC + DataGuard是一个复杂的过程,它涉及多个步骤,每个步骤都需要仔细执行以确保系统的稳定性和数据完整性。通过遵循这个指南,企业可以构建一个可靠且易于管理的高可用性环境,降低潜在的风险并提升业务连续性。